Topic: Rooted: Growing Deep Before Going Far (3)

Focus: The Root Determines the Fruit


🔥 Message:

Before God launches you, He grounds you. This devotional series will help you embrace the beauty of spiritual formation, character development, and divine preparation. Like a tree, your destiny is determined by how deep your roots go. You were not made to wither under pressure — you were made to stand strong, grow tall, and bear lasting fruit. But first, you must be rooted.



📖 Key Verse:

“He is like a tree planted by streams of water, which yields its fruit in season and whose leaf does not wither—whatever they do prospers.” – Psalm 1:3 (NIV)


Devotional:
Before you ever see the fruit of a life, examine the root. You don’t get peace, joy, power, or purity from shallow, compromised soil. Just as a tree cannot bear healthy fruit without a healthy root system, a believer cannot produce lasting results without being rooted in Christ. Jesus said, “I am the Vine; you are the branches. Apart from Me, you can do nothing” (John 15:5). That’s not a suggestion—it’s a reality. We can only bear fruit that glorifies God when we’re connected to Him consistently, deeply, and sincerely.

💧 Refreshing for the Day:
So, beloved, what are your roots drawing from? Are they anchored in God’s Word or worldly opinions? Are they feeding on truth or trends? Fruit is never random. It’s the result of what’s flowing underground. To live a fruitful life, stay rooted in God’s presence, God’s voice, and God’s Word. Your life will always bear the fruit of whatever your roots are feeding on. Stay Refreshed!
